## Salesforce Developer (VPUR)Applylocations: University of Maryland College Parktime type: Full timeposted on: Posted Todayjob requisition id: JR104584# **Job Description Summary**Organization's Summary Statement: University Relations is implementing Salesforce CRM as part of a multi-year advancement and data modernization initiative. To support the long-term stability, scalability, and extensibility of the Salesforce platform following implementation, University Relations requires a Salesforce Developer to provide hands-on custom development and integration expertise. The Salesforce Developer is responsible for designing, developing, testing, and maintaining custom Salesforce solutions, including Apex code, Lightning Web Components (LWC), and Salesforce-side integration components. This role focuses on extending Salesforce capabilities beyond declarative configuration, supporting integrations, and stabilizing custom logic delivered by implementation partners. In addition to hands-on development responsibilities, this role provides technical leadership and direct supervision of the Salesforce Administrator, coordinating declarative configuration and custom development efforts to ensure alignment with overall architecture standards and best practices. The Salesforce Developer must also be prepared to assume Salesforce Administrator responsibilities during the Administrator's scheduled or unscheduled absences (including military reserve training, extended leave, or other planned coverage periods) to ensure continuity of platform operations, user support, and business-critical processes. The position reports to the Director of Data Management and works in close partnership with Salesforce Administrators, Data Engineers, Analytics Engineers, and business stakeholders. Declarative configuration, platform governance, and day-to-day administration remain the responsibility of the Salesforce Administrator; this role provides custom development and technical implementation support aligned with established architecture and governance standards.
